PPG has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 2,644 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The PPG employ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Manufacturing indust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

Not many... I guess if I had to mention one it would be work/life balance. Stores mostly closed on weekends and reps not expected to work.

Cons

Clueless middle and upper management is the biggest one. Also, company paid considerably less than most competitors. No organization chart, no HR support, no LP presence. No room for advancement as they constantly look outside the company instead of promoting from within. For such a large company, benefits are average at best and pretty expensive. No appreciation from middle and upper management for delivering results. Instead they like to either nitpick you over little things or say nothing at all and get rid of you. Little or no training provided as middle management is completely incompetent and have no clue where to start. I could go on and on.... stay away from the stores division unless you like being treated with little respect, like being underpaid and underappreciated, and enjoy being taught next to nothing but expected to deliver results.

Pros

People who work hard are given plenty of opportunities for advancement. Employees are generally treated very well and with a lot of respect. People who work here tend to stay for a long time, often their entire career - for good reason.

Cons

The corporate culture is very conservative, and PPG has a few of the same issues that other international companies face - business units can be pretty segmented.
